AI governance hiring amid persistent selling pressure
Novo Nordisk announced a newly created position for an AI Governance Engineer — Project Manager to advance AI governance and enablement across its organization. The position will support enterprise-scale AI projects and focus on aligning technical execution with corporate strategy and stakeholder needs. The company stated this role is part of broader efforts to embed responsible AI practices and further its long-term health innovation initiatives, though price action has remained under broader selling pressure.
Overbought signals diverge as bullish momentum meets resistance
NVO trades above the SMA-20 ($38.85) and SMA-50 ($39.05) but remains well below the SMA-200 ($50.46). The Ichimoku Kijun support stands at $38.58. On the momentum side, MACD is bullish on the daily chart, whereas ADX measures a weak trend at 18.14. The RSI reading is above 60, CCI is over 100, and both Stoch RSI and Bull/Bear Power (BBP) signal intraday overbought conditions and strong buyer dominance. Awesome Oscillator aligns with the upward D1 trend. The session began nearly flat and the price has shifted toward the midpoint of today’s $41.10 – $42.08 range, exhibiting moderate volatility and light pressure post-open. Despite bullish momentum, varied overbought indications and a softer daily close show divergence and a risk of near-term pullbacks.
Rangebound outlook as upside risk remains muted
NVO is likely to remain within a $40.39 to $41.90 range next week, consistent with typical volatility bands relative to current levels. The probability of a significant upward move is very low (under 20%), as weekly longer-term technicals remain bearish. Scenario analysis favors sideways movement; a sustained close above resistance is required for a bullish scenario, while a break below $40.39 support could trigger a renewed medium-term decline.
